Myth 1: Wholesale Means Inferior Quality
One of the most prevalent misconceptions is that wholesale products are of lower quality. In reality, wholesale golf supplies are often the same brands and products you find in retail stores. The difference lies in the pricing structure. Retailers buy in bulk to receive discounts, which they can then pass on to consumers. Buying wholesale doesn’t mean sacrificing quality; it means taking advantage of bulk purchasing power.
Myth 2: Only Businesses Can Buy Wholesale
Another common misconception is that only businesses can purchase wholesale golf supplies. While it’s true that many wholesalers cater primarily to businesses, many also offer options for individual buyers. Some wholesalers have minimum order requirements, but these are often accessible to avid golfers looking to stock up on their favorite supplies.

Myth 3: Limited Product Variety
Some assume that wholesale suppliers offer a limited selection of products. On the contrary, wholesalers often have a vast array of options, from clubs and balls to apparel and accessories. They work with multiple manufacturers and brands, allowing them to provide diverse inventory to meet the needs of different buyers.
Benefits of Buying Wholesale
Beyond debunking myths, it's essential to understand the benefits of buying wholesale. One of the primary advantages is cost savings. Purchasing in bulk reduces the per-unit cost, making it a cost-effective option for those who need larger quantities. Additionally, wholesalers can offer exclusive deals and promotions that aren't available to retail buyers.

How to Choose a Wholesale Supplier
Selecting the right wholesale supplier is crucial. Here are some tips to help you make an informed decision:
- Research the supplier’s reputation and read customer reviews.
- Compare pricing and terms with other wholesalers.
- Check the minimum order requirements and shipping policies.
By taking these steps, you can ensure a smooth purchasing experience and receive high-quality products.
